DAY 5

Today, we’ll head to the Corinth Canal, where you’ll make a brief stop to take photos and admire this famous waterway that connects the Aegean Sea and the Gulf of Corinth. This impressive engineering marvel eliminates the need for ships to travel over 400 kilometers around the Peloponnese peninsula to reach the Ionian Sea.

Continuing on our journey, we’ll reach the Theater of Epidaurus, renowned worldwide for its exceptional acoustics and still used today for various performances, particularly during the summer. We’ll also have time to explore the Archaeological Museum of Epidaurus, which pays homage to the origins of modern medicine.

Next, we’ll travel to the city of Mycenae, where you’ll have the opportunity to visit the prehistoric Acropolis, the iconic Lions Gate, and the tomb of Agamemnon.

DAY 6

In the morning, you will visit the site of the ancient Olympic stadium, where the first games were held at around 776 BC.

The importance of these games was widely accepted, given the extensive participation of the Greek cities, which suspended hostilities throughout the celebrations. The Olympiad was recognized as the only chronological event in Greece and represented four years between two consecutive events.

Olympia was also the most important sanctuary of Ancient Greece, a place to worship Zeus, the first among the gods. The gigantic gold and ivory sculpture crafted by Phidias was considered one of the seven wonders of the ancient world.

DAY 8

Early in the morning, you will visit Meteora, decl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O in 1988. In this mysterious landscape, the natural beauty is combined with the compelling presence of the eternal monasteries suspended or “Meteora” on top of the huge rocks. Currently, there are only six in use, five for the male and one for the female monastic community.

Dress code to the Monasteries: Sleeveless clothing and shorts above the knee are not allowed. Skirts, shawls, and trousers are available at the entrance of the Monasteries in case visitors do not have such clothing to cover themselves with.

On the way back to Athens, you will briefly stop at Thermopylae, where you can see the statue of the Spartan King Leonidas, famous for leading the battle against the Persians in 480 BC. In the late afternoon, you will arrive in Athens, where we will drop you off at your hotel.
